About Cancer Research UK Scotland Institute

The Cancer Research UK Scotland Institute, situated at Switchback Rd, Bearsden, Glasgow G61 1BD, is a beacon of hope and innovation in the fight against cancer. This esteemed research institute is closely affiliated with the University of Glasgow and is an integral part of the Cancer Research UK network. It specializes in cutting-edge cancer research, offering comprehensive postgraduate training programs for aspiring PhD students.

The Beatson Institute for Cancer Research is a world-renowned research institute located in Bearsden, Glasgow, United Kingdom. It is affiliated with the University of Glasgow and is part of the Cancer Research UK network of research institutions. The Institute is dedicated to cancer research and offers postgraduate training programs for PhD students. It is easily accessible by car and public transport.
